Transaction 528035ada738cc8ddb7da236a0e820bf298da27d9d87916811dd7361814fab57

2 Input
2 Outputs
  • 528035ada738cc8ddb7da236a0e820bf298da27d9d87916811dd7361814fab57:0
  • value  16960464
    address  1LW5Fwb9E4dfZgMpAkp9CKkq2key8qt67n
  • 528035ada738cc8ddb7da236a0e820bf298da27d9d87916811dd7361814fab57:1
  • value  26961936
    address  3583aWkHieuRHjVHkyTnV2taaRCEDKLCVd